Dell Latitude Series by cs_developer_cpp_ in Dell

[–]thenew3 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Latitude 3xxx and 5xxx series are the lower end with lower material quality. More plastic, thicker and heavier build. Latitude 7xxx and 9xxx series are built with top notch material. The aluminum shell is similar to macbook. There are also carbon fiber and magnesium versions.

You want something to last a long time, get a 7xxx or 9xxx series.

Replacing SSD by he8282882jsjjd_7 in Dell

[–]thenew3 0 points1 point  (0 children)

You can lookup specific directions on the dell support site. put in you service tag, click on documentation, and one of the document links gives you specific step by step on how to take the computer apart and remove/install SSD.

On the software side, you'll need to either clone your existing drive onto the new drive, or install the OS from scratch. If you plan to install from scratch, get a usb flash drive (8gb or larger) assuming you're using windows 11, download the latest ISO or media creation tool from microsoft and create a bootable USB drive that you can use to install the OS on the new drive. Might as well download all the drivers from Dell and put them on the usb drive as well. make sure your bios is in AHCI mode instead of RAID to have the windows installer see the drive.

Dell pro max 18 plus battery wear after 15 cycles by Fled_Nenders in Dell

[–]thenew3 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Do a battery calibration, run it down to 0% (you may have to go into bios and let it sit to drain the last few %). then charge it to 100% and see what it says.

It's not unusual for a new battery to show capacity lower than design capacity. Most new Dell laptops we receive (thousands of latitude and precisions every year) show anywhere from 0-10% less than design capacity fresh from the factory.

Need help finding a good battery replacement seller by lords_o_leaping in Dell

[–]thenew3 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Genuine Dell batteries from ebay have the same life as batteries directly from Dell. They all start to show significant reduction in charge capacity after 12-18 months and die or only have 1/2 or less of capacity after 2-3 years. If you carefully control charge cycles you may get 3-5 years before it drops down to 1/2 capacity or less.

The non-genuine batteries often start off with lower capacity and starts to get reduced capacity after just a couple of months and die after a year or two.

Laptop batteries aren't designed to the same standard as EV batteries. No need to compare the two.
